The language is controlled by your web browser -- you've
probably got it configured to give something other than
English higher priority.

Hi,
The status is that there is no status. :) Due to dependence on CVS and the
fact it needs to be proofread as well before going back online, we're pretty
much stuck as is until quite a few man-hours are spent.
elmo and I are likely going to restore packages.d.o and cgi.d.o first.
